def sys_exec(cmd, options = {})
env = options[:env] || {}
env["RUBYOPT"] = opt_add(opt_add("-r#{spec_dir}/support/switch_rubygems.rb", env["RUBYOPT"]), ENV["RUBYOPT"])
dir = options[:dir] || bundled_app
command_execution = CommandExecution.new(cmd.to_s, dir)
require "open3"
require "shellwords"
Open3.popen3(env, *cmd.shellsplit, :chdir => dir) do |stdin, stdout, stderr, wait_thr|
yield stdin, stdout, wait_thr if block_given?
stdin.close
stdout_read_thread = Thread.new { stdout.read }
stderr_read_thread = Thread.new { stderr.read }
command_execution.stdout = stdout_read_thread.value.strip
command_execution.stderr = stderr_read_thread.value.strip
status = wait_thr.value
command_execution.exitstatus = if status.exited?
status.exitstatus
elsif status.signaled?
exit_status_for_signal(status.termsig)
end
end
unless options[:raise_on_error] == false || command_execution.success?
raise <<~ERROR
Invoking `#{cmd}` failed with output:
----------------------------------------------------------------------
#{command_execution.stdboth}
----------------------------------------------------------------------
ERROR
end
command_executions << command_execution
command_execution.stdout
end
